Output 76b60893feb61ffc0b40fcb59663959ddc215c66962a30e460fdbca113bbe9c4:1

value
2381741474
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 630f9c269f70b312f4262b93759bf558ada30cfe OP_EQUALVERIFY OP_CHECKSIG
address
1A2nbbFc1AaLHkPSkiaDadXqYEcVnrn3aE
transaction
76b60893feb61ffc0b40fcb59663959ddc215c66962a30e460fdbca113bbe9c4
spent
true